Latest Patents
One of Carter's latest patents involves a method for determining the remaining amount of material in a material package. This invention utilizes location data and a beacon code to track the movement of the material package. By periodically reporting the location data from a beacon located near the package, the system can ascertain whether the package has been used. Once the weight of the used material is received, the system queries a material database to calculate the remaining amount of material based on the recorded weight and data from the material package record.
